Abstract

The utility model provides a fastening structure of axletree on bumper shock absorber belongs to vehicle part technical field. It has solved between current shock absorber outer cylinder and the handle pole problem that wearing and tearing were changeed to the contact surface. This fastening structure of axletree on bumper shock absorber, this bumper shock absorber include left urceolus and right urceolus, and the cavity structure of inside for supplying bumper shock absorber handle pole to stretch into of left urceolus and right urceolus is provided with axle sleeve no. 1 on the right urceolus lower extreme lateral wall, be provided with axial open -ended axle sleeve no. 2 on the left urceolus lower extreme lateral wall, and two opening part both sides on the axle sleeve have linked firmly mutually support installation piece and locating piece respectively, have seted up the screw on installation piece and the locating piece, are provided with the strengthening rib between two tops on the axle sleeve and the left urceolus. The utility model has the advantages of higher life is longer for the adjustment.

Background technology
Amortisseur is mainly used to suppress concussion when rebounding after the impact and spring shock-absorbing on road surface.Through uneven During road surface, although shock-absorbing spring can filter the vibrations on road surface, but spring itself also has reciprocating motion, and amortisseur is exactly to use To suppress this spring jump.Amortisseur is connected to play cushioning effect, traditional company by the axletree with motor vehicles Connect the axle sleeve that axletree two ends are typically each passed through mode left and right amortisseur, by screw clamp nut on the outside of two axle sleeves come Fixed effect is played, although the axiality between this fastening means simple structure fastening rear shock absorber outer tube and shank It is not high, because when clamp nut rotates tension, two amortisseur outer tube easily form interior expansion, when clamp nut rotates through pine, Two amortisseur outer tube are easily outer in use to be opened, therefore traditional fixed structure is easily made between amortisseur outer tube and shank Frictional force increase contact surface it is more easy to wear, reduce the service life of amortisseur.
